Coleman Linked to Welsh Job!

With rumours circulating that our ex-manager could be about to face the axe at Real Sociedad, could another job opportunity be about to present itself?

Today, a leading tabloid carries an article containing several comments made by the Blackburn midfielder, Robbie Savage.

They surround the current predicament Welsh football finds itself in hard on the heels of a 2-0 defeat against Germany, at the weekend, with only 25,000 supporters turning up.

Now it`s no secret that Savage has never seen eye-to-eye with the current Welsh manager, John Toshack. Indeed, the two have often been at each others throats and Savage has effectively blamed Toshack for the termination of his own international career.

However, Savage has effectively called for Toshack to stand down and give someone else the chance to resurrect Welsh football and spearhead the campaign to qualify for the 2010 World Cup.

The person he has chosen is, perhaps surprisingly, Chris Coleman, with Savage remarking,

"I think the time has come to make a change at the top and Chris Coleman has to be a candidate."

"He did well at Fulham and is a young man with ideas. We need that because we can`t go on as we are."

Quite how Chris views matters isn`t clear. We here at Vital Fulham suggest that perhaps he`d probably like to make a go of the Real Sociedad job before taking on another.
